1. Exploring Nietzsche’s Philosophy: Uncovering the Path to a Meaningful Existence

Friedrich Nietzsche, a renowned philosopher of the 19th century, offers deep insights into the nature of existence and the pursuit of meaning. His philosophy challenges traditional notions and encourages individuals to embark on a journey of self-discovery and self-creation. By exploring Nietzsche’s ideas on the will to power, the eternal recurrence, and the concept of the Übermensch, we can uncover a path towards a meaningful existence. Nietzsche’s philosophy invites us to question societal norms, embrace our individuality, and take responsibility for our own lives, ultimately leading to a more fulfilled and authentic way of living.

2. Nietzsche’s Existentialism Unveiled: Navigating Life’s Meaning and Purpose

Existentialism, as popularized by Friedrich Nietzsche, shines a light on the inherent meaninglessness of existence and the responsibility each individual has to create their own purpose. In Nietzsche’s view, life is devoid of intrinsic meaning, and it is up to each individual to navigate their own path towards a meaningful existence. By embracing the struggle and acknowledging the uncertainty of life, Nietzsche’s existentialism encourages us to explore our passions, overcome societal constraints, and find our unique purpose. Through this journey, we can overcome nihilism and discover a profound sense of fulfillment and self-actualization.

3. Living Authentically: Friedrich Nietzsche’s Guide to a Meaningful Existential Life

Friedrich Nietzsche’s philosophy offers a guide to living an authentic and meaningful existential life. Nietzsche encourages us to break free from societal expectations and prescribed roles, allowing our true selves to emerge. By questioning traditional values and norms, we can resist conformity and embrace our individuality. Nietzsche’s philosophy of self-overcoming urges us to continually challenge ourselves, confront our fears, and grow beyond our limitations. Through this process, we can achieve personal transformation and forge our own path towards a genuine and purposeful existence.

5. A Roadmap to Existential Living: Friedrich Nietzsche’s Perspectives on the Meaning of Life

Friedrich Nietzsche presents a roadmap for existential living, offering perspectives on the meaning of life. According to Nietzsche, the meaning of life lies in the process of becoming. He encourages us to embrace the inevitable struggles and pain of existence as opportunities for growth and self-improvement. By cultivating our unique strengths and talents, and by constantly striving to overcome our limitations, we can tap into our full potential as individuals. Nietzsche’s philosophy offers a powerful framework to live a purpose-driven life by constructing our meaning through self-awareness, self-affirmation, and relentless self-transcendence.
